Where 400kW Storage Shines: Top Use Cases
Think of 400kW systems as the "Swiss Army knife" of energy storage – powerful enough for factories yet adaptable for commercial complexes. Let's break down the numbers:
- Manufacturing plants: 72% of surveyed facilities reduced peak demand charges by 30-45%
- Solar farms: Paired with 500-800kW PV arrays for 24/7 renewable supply
- Data centers: Provides 8-12 minutes of critical backup power during grid failures
Cost-Benefit Breakdown
Application | ROI Period | Annual Savings |
---|---|---|
Industrial Load Shifting | 3.8 years | $58,000-$72,000 |
Commercial Peak Shaving | 4.2 years | $41,000-$55,000 |

Choosing Your Solution: 3 Key Factors
- Cycle life rating (aim for 6,000+ cycles)
- Thermal management capabilities
- Warranty coverage (minimum 10 years)

FAQ: 400kW Energy Storage Systems
- Q: How much space does a 400kW system require?A: Typically 20-30 sqm including safety clearances
- Q: Can I expand capacity later?A: Yes, modular designs allow 50kW increments
- Q: What's the typical lifespan?A: 15-20 years with proper maintenance
